Through the recent kind efforts of several individuals researching on my behalf, I possess data from the Censuses of 1851, 1861 and 1881, and IGI. Now, my problem:

FACT:

Mary McCREADIE, mother of both
Margaret McCREADIE (b. 13 Nov 1859, Ballantrae d. unknown)
William McCREADIE (b. 7 Aug 1866, Ballantrae d. 04 Aug 1941, Dunedin, NZ)
[As Informant of each birth, Mary signed both Birth Extracts. Her signature is exactly the same on each.]

It must be pointed out that circa 1860, there were two Mary McCREADIEs giving birth in Ballantrae. I know only that at the time of her daughter Margaret’s birth, Mary was described as “Domestic Servant” while at the time of William’s birth, she was described as “Cook”.

THEORY:

If Mary McCREADIE conformed with Scottish patronymic customs, Margaret was named for her grandmother. I have IGI data of a Margaret (DOAK) McCREADIE as a possible mother who, on 5th June 1835 at Girvan, married a James McCREDDIE (sic). In addition, I also possess the Death Extract of a Margaret DUFF, widow of John DUFF, Shepherd. Margaret DUFF died 15 April 1880, aged 41 Years. Her parents were Hugh and Elizabeth (DOAK) McCREADIE (deceased at time of Margaret DUFFs death). The Informant of Margaret DUFFs death was “Margaret DOAK or McCREADIE, Nurse, Present” written in her own handwriting. I am unable to determine if these are the same Margaret McCREADIE.

Located in the 1851 Census of Ballantrae is a James McCREADIE, age 40 and Margaret (DOAK) McCREADIE, age 37, with a daughter Mary who was christened on 25th February 1840 at Ballantrae. This daughter would have been of child bearing age when Margaret McCREADIE was born in 1859. Located in the 1881 Census of Ballantrae, is a Margaret McCREADIE, age 67, born Girvan with her grandchildren Maggie, age 22, and William, age 15. Both Maggie and William are the correct ages to match the birth years of my forebears.

AIM:
To positively identify and locate Mary McCREADIE’s mother, possibly Margaret (DOAK) McCREADIE.

I would be extremely grateful for any and all assistance to resolve this.

Hi Jim,
Some answers - at least i hope there are.
This looks like the parents of Mary McCREADIE born 1840.
The age of Margaret DOAK as 57 yrs on her 1889 DC is well adrift - around 18 years out....
But i can't see her being any other than the Margaret that is at Shellknowe in 1881 as aged 67.
My only problem is - who is son Robert?
==
1877 DC 579. 6 (Ballantrae)
James McCREADIE (66) fisherman, d. 12 MAR 1877 at Ballantrae.
Married to Margaret DOAK.
Parents - John McCREADIE (dcd) thatcher & Mary m/s FERGUSSON (dcd)
Informant - Robert McCREADIE, son, Shorehouse, Stevenston.

--
1889 DC 579. 1 (Ballantrae)
Margaret McCREADIE (57) d. 2 FEB 1889 at Shellknowe.
Widow of James McCREADIE, fisherman.
Parents - Robert DOAK (dcd) hand loom weaver & Mary m/s McCREADIE (dcd).
Informant - Robert McCREADIE, son, Schoolwell Street, Stevenston.

==
I'd a look at the signature of informant Margaret DOAK or McCREADIE on Margaret DUFF's 1880 DC.
I'm as certain as can be it's the same hand that signed wee Mary McCREADIE's 1861 BC. ie grandmother Margaret McCREADIE.

So we can only make a guess that Margaret McCREADIE m/s DOAK could well be related to
Margaret DUFF's mother Elizabeth McCREADIE m/s DOAK.
I'll be very surprised if not - so maybe you've a bit of work to do!
==
And now back to Mary McCREADIE born 1840.
I can't find an "official" marriage for her to Robert JONES - but their children's BCs say they married 2 APR 1869 at West Calder.
Though Robert Jones (20) did marry Isabella Brannan (19) on 1 JUN 1857 at Bathgate West Lothian.
(his parents are given as John Jones, miner & Laura Lloyd - both deceased; the same names as on his DC)
But Isabella then died aged 22 on 5 Dec 1860 at Longridge, W. Lothian.
In 1861 Robert Jones (25) miner, born Wales is staying with his father-in-law James at Longridge.

Hi Jim,
It might be useful to do an in depth study of the McCREADIEs & DOAKs
plus their inter-related families in the Ballantrae / Girvan area.
This to get a much better understanding of them; they seem quite numerous.
But once you start they'll probably make much more sense as you "get to know them".
--
I can only guess (possibly very wrongly) on who the informant son Robert is.
Could he be the 5yr old Thomas in 1841?
But that the name should've been Robert - the enumerator getting it wrong?
Or Thomas changed his name to Robert? That seems rather doubtful though.
There is a suitably aged 15yr old *Robert McCREADIE in 1851 - please see below,
but I can't see him in Ayrshire 1861 - posssibly elsewhere?
I don't know if this is the right Robert - he's the only one i can see in 1851 that might be.
I should mention that there doesn't appear to be a suitable Thomas aged about 15yrs in 1851.
--
Later - I'd a look at the LDS BIVRI; there is a *Robert :D
So it does appear that Thomas was an error in 1841.
Parents of all the children below are James McCREDIE & Margaret DOAK
-
*Robert MCCREDIE, Birth: 18 Oct 1835 Christening: 27 Nov 1835 Ballantrae, Ayrshire, Scotland
Mathew MCREDIE, Birth: 2 Nov 1837 Christening: 3 Nov 1837 Ballantrae, Ayrshire, Scotland
Mary MCCREDIE, Birth: 28 Jan 1840 Christening: 25 Feb 1840 Ballantrae, Ayrshire, Scotland
Margaret MCCREDIE, Birth: 9 May 1842 Christening: 22 May 1842 Ballantrae, Ayrshire, Scotland
David MCCREDIE, Birth: 15 Nov 1844 Christening: 8 Dec 1844 Ballantrae, Ayrshire, Scotland
James MCCREDIE, Birth: 5 Dec 1846 Christening: 20 Dec 1846 Ballantrae, Ayrshire, Scotland
James Meikle MCCREDIE, Birth: 23 Dec 1847 Christening: 6 Feb 1848 Ballantrae, Ayrshire, Scotland
Jean MCCREDIE, Birth: 1 Feb 1851 Christening: 9 Mar 1851 Ballantrae, Ayrshire, Scotland

--
In Stevenston 1881 there is a Robert McCREADIE aged 40, salmon fisher, born Ballantrae.
(details at bottom of this page)
As you say, Robert the informant would need to be the brother of Mary born 1840.
